Colorado Blue Spruce (Picea Pungens) is a perennial tree in the Pinaceae family with easy care difficulty. It requires moderate watering and full sun or partial shade light in USDA hardiness zones 2-7. This plant is safe for cats and dogs.

Picea pungens, known as Colorado blue spruce, is a medium to large evergreen conifer prized for its striking blue-green needles and symmetrical pyramidal form.
